Mesothelioma Class Action Lawsuit Settlements

After a diagnosis of asbestos exposure, a lot of asbestos victims face financial difficulties. Compensation can assist with funeral costs medical expenses, as well as lost wages.

Settlements for mesothelioma tend to be more efficient than a court decision. However lawsuit trials can be dangerous and can take years to complete. A jury or judge decides what amount of compensation the plaintiff should receive.

Compensation

If a victim is diagnosed with mesothelioma, or other asbestos-related illnesses they are entitled receive compensation from responsible companies. The compensation they receive can help pay for medical expenses as well as other expenses related to living with mesothelioma. Many patients are also eligible for workers compensation (WC), a state-mandated insurance program that covers the costs related to workplace injuries.

Mesothelioma patients may also be able to recover compensation for their pain, suffering, and the loss of loved family members. Because confidentiality agreements exist, the exact settlement amounts are typically kept private. Typically, jurors will award victims a mixture of punitive and compensatory damages.

Compensation may differ based on the kind of cancer, the location where the victim was first diagnosed and the age at the time they were diagnosed. In the majority of cases, those diagnosed with mesothelioma in their 50s and 60s receive higher settlements than those diagnosed at an earlier age. This is because mesothelioma diagnosis is a significant factor in the victim's ability to work and remain at home.

In addition, the amount of money received from a mesothelioma suit may differ based on the location where the case was filed and which companies were named in the lawsuit. Asbestos lawyers can provide an explanation of the effects of different laws, award caps and statutes on the plaintiff's claim.

Asbestos sufferers can file a personal injuries claim against a variety of asbestos companies or other companies they believe are accountable for. In some cases, these claims may be settled through a multi-district lawsuit. However, it is recommended to meet with an experienced mesothelioma lawyer to determine the best method to proceed with their case.

In certain cases the company may offer to settle a mesothelioma case without the need for a jury trial. This is usually the case when a large amount of evidence exists supporting the victim's claim and it is in the best interest of both parties to avoid having a trial.

In some instances mesothelioma cases will be tried in court because the victim and the asbestos company cannot agree on a settlement. This is uncommon, as the vast majority of asbestos patients are able to negotiate a settlement with the responsible party.

Statute of Limitations

A mesothelioma lawsuit can aid the victims and their families seek compensation for the many costs related to asbestos exposure. Medical expenses, lost wages, and other expenses can be included in this compensation. A mesothelioma lawsuit can provide compensation for the victim's suffering and pain. However it is important to remember that mesothelioma judgments and settlements can be highly erratic and cannot be guaranteed.

When filing mesothelioma claims it is essential that patients work with a skilled lawyer. This legal professional can help patients prove their asbestos exposure, file the appropriate paperwork with the court and represent them in all negotiations and court proceedings. If the aim is to achieve a mesothelioma settlement or a trial verdict The lawyer will fight for what they believe to be fair.

In most cases, victims or their families can only bring a lawsuit for 2 years after the date of diagnosis (for claims related to personal injury) or the death of a loved ones (for claims relating to wrongful death). In some instances there are exceptions. However, it is important for victims to know their rights and act as quickly as they can.

Mesothelioma lawyers are able to assist their clients with all aspects of a mesothelioma suit, including determining the proper statute of limitations for their case. They can assist victims and their family members discover other compensation sources, such as veterans' benefits or bankruptcy trusts.

If a mesothelioma verdict is not in your favor, lawyers can help appeal the verdict. This procedure can take time and may delay the payment.

Timeline

Mesothelioma cases are usually dealt with as personal injury claims or wrongful death suits. The compensation resulting from these lawsuits could aid victims and their families recover the funds needed to cover treatment costs funeral expenses, lost wages, and other losses.

The first step would be to engage an attorney to look into your asbestos exposure and to identify potential defendants. A mesothelioma lawyer with experience has access to a database that can assist in identifying asbestos companies and products that are linked to mesothelioma. Once the attorney has gathered all of the relevant information, he or she can file a lawsuit on behalf of you.

You can bring a lawsuit on behalf of yourself to seek compensation for your injuries or loss from the makers of asbestos and asbestos-related items. The lawsuit is based on the mesothelioma, location, and exposure you've experienced. The more information that your attorney has regarding the mesothelioma you suffer from and its location the better he will be able to determine the amount of compensation you should seek.

After your lawyer files your mesothelioma lawsuit they will begin the process of contact with asbestos companies mentioned in the suit. This process can take several months based on the laws of the state. Asbestos companies are usually reluctant to settle claims if they believe their products aren't to blame. However, mesothelioma attorneys are skilled in reaching settlements.

In most cases, a mesothelioma claim will settle before trial. A trial can prolong the mesothelioma lawsuit's timeline by a couple of years or more. During this time your lawyer will assist you develop a trial plan. This could include preparing for depositions or filing motions.

Verdict

If the parties cannot reach an agreement the case will go to trial. A jury will review all the evidence prior to reaching a settlement figure which is also known as a verdict. This is the final word in the case, and could have a significant impact on the amount a victim is compensated.

During the trial phase, both teams will gather evidence and documents to back their claims. Your mesothelioma lawyer will talk with current and former employees of the companies responsible for your exposure to asbestos, including those that may have witnessed asbestos contamination or use. They will prepare you for a deposition, which will be a testimonies about your mesothelioma.

Mesothelioma verdicts usually result in higher payouts than settlements. The majority of lawsuits are settled because the companies don't want to risk a trial with large jury payouts.

The time-limit for mesothelioma varies from state to state, however the majority of people diagnosed with the disease can be compensated through a lawsuit. Asbestos victims or their heirs could sue to recover compensation from the corporations or trusts responsible for their exposure to asbestos and subsequent diagnosis of mesothelioma.

Asbestos victims are also able to seek compensation through the VA or a mesothelioma trust fund. These options are usually quicker and more straightforward than a lawsuit.
